Abstract

We provide the system. [Solution] A means including multiple artificial intelligences that collect data related to urban management and perform analyses on energy, transportation, and the environment based on said data, A means for conducting virtual meetings among multiple artificial intelligences, integrating urban management information, and generating an optimal management plan, A means for automatically executing urgent management instructions based on the generated management plan, A means of notifying the user of the results of the execution and enabling them to make further decisions, A system that includes this.

Claims

1. A means including multiple artificial intelligences that collect data related to urban management and perform analyses on energy, transportation, and the environment based on said data, A means for conducting virtual meetings among multiple artificial intelligences, integrating urban management information, and generating an optimal management plan, A means for automatically executing urgent management instructions based on the generated management plan, A means of notifying the user of the results of the execution and enabling them to make further decisions, A system that includes this.

2. The system according to claim 1, further comprising means for automatically normalizing and classifying collected data and storing it in an information set.

3. The system according to claim 1, further comprising means for implementing a machine learning algorithm to learn urban usage patterns and improve prediction accuracy.
